Market Overview: Frameless LED Panel Lights in China

Frameless LED panel lights are characterized by their sleek, minimalist design—lacking a visible bezel—which enhances aesthetic appeal in modern architectural lighting. These products are typically used in offices, hospitals, schools, shopping malls, and premium homes.

China produces over 75% of the world’s LED lighting products, with frameless panel lights representing a growing segment due to rising demand in smart buildings and sustainable construction. The Chinese LED lighting market is projected to grow at a CAGR of 8.2% (2024–2026), driven by technological upgrades, export demand, and domestic infrastructure development.


Key Industrial Clusters for Frameless LED Panel Light Manufacturing

China’s LED lighting industry is highly regionalized, with production concentrated in a few key provinces and cities known for their specialized ecosystems, supplier networks, and export infrastructure.

1. Guangdong Province (Guangzhou, Shenzhen, Zhongshan, Foshan)

  • Zhongshan City is recognized as the “Capital of Lighting” in China, hosting over 10,000 lighting manufacturers.
  • Shenzhen leads in R&D, smart lighting integration, and export logistics.
  • Dominates high-volume, export-oriented production with strong OEM/ODM capabilities.

2. Zhejiang Province (Ningbo, Hangzhou, Huzhou)

  • Ningbo is a hub for precision metal fabrication and high-efficiency assembly.
  • Strong focus on mid-to-high tier quality, with increasing automation.
  • Proximity to Shanghai port facilitates international shipping.

3. Jiangsu Province (Suzhou, Wuxi)

  • Known for advanced electronics and semiconductor components, supporting high-performance LED drivers and optics.
  • Manufacturers often serve European and North American premium markets.

4. Fujian Province (Xiamen)

  • Emerging cluster with lower labor and operational costs.
  • Attracts budget-conscious buyers, though quality consistency varies.

Note: Over 60% of frameless LED panel light production is concentrated in Guangdong and Zhejiang, making them the primary sourcing regions for global buyers.

I. Technical Specifications & Quality Parameters

A. Core Material Requirements

Component Minimum Specification Tolerance Why It Matters
PCB Substrate FR-4 Aluminum-core (≥1.0mm thickness) ±0.1mm Prevents warping at >40°C ambient; thinner substrates cause lumen depreciation >20% in 12 months
Diffuser PMMA (Optical Grade, 2.5mm) Transmittance ≥92% PS/Glass alternatives cause yellowing in 18 months; PMMA maintains color consistency
LED Chips Epistar/Samsung 3030 (CRI ≥90, SDCM ≤3) Binning: 3-step MacAdam Non-compliant bins create visible color shifts in contiguous installations
Driver Constant Current (IEC 61347-2-13 Class II) Ripple <10% High ripple causes flicker (stroboscopic effect); UL8750 requires <5% for healthcare
Frame Anodized 6063-T5 Aluminum (width: 8–12mm) ±0.05mm Wider frames (>12mm) negate “frameless” aesthetic; thinner frames warp during shipping

B. Performance Tolerances (Per ISO 14644-1:2024)

  • Lumen Maintenance: L70 ≥ 50,000 hours (TM-21-19 tested)
  • Color Shift: Δu’v’ ≤ 0.0011 after 6,000h (IES LM-80)
  • Surface Uniformity: Min. 85% (measured per CIE 127:2022)
  • Thermal Management: Max. case temp. ≤65°C at 25°C ambient (IEC 60598-1)

Procurement Tip: Require factory test reports for every batch showing LM-80 data. 68% of non-compliant panels fail due to unverified lumen claims (SourcifyChina 2025 Audit).

III. Common Quality Defects & Prevention Strategies

Defect Root Cause Prevention Protocol Cost of Failure
Edge Light Leakage Poor diffuser sealing; frame warpage >0.3mm Require: 0.5mm silicone gasket + frame flatness test (dial indicator ±0.1mm) $18–$32/panel rework
Flicker (>5% SVM) Driver ripple >15%; incompatible dimmers Require: Flicker testing per IEEE 1789-2015; only use DALI-2 certified drivers 100% rejection (US healthcare)
Color Inconsistency Mixed LED bins; no SDCM sorting Require: 3-step MacAdam binning + batch-specific spectrometer reports (CIE 1931) $220k+ in project recalls (2025 case)
Yellowing Diffuser Low-grade PMMA (<92% transmittance) Require: UV resistance test (ISO 4892-2) + FTIR material verification 30% lumen loss at 12mo
PCB Delamination Substandard FR-4; poor thermal management Require: TMA thermal stress test (260°C x 30s) + thermal imaging at full load Fire hazard (UL 8750 Ch. 16)

2. OEM vs. ODM: Strategic Sourcing Pathways

Model Description Suitability
OEM (Original Equipment Manufacturing) Manufacturer produces lights to buyer’s exact specifications (design, materials, performance). Buyer retains full IP control. Ideal for established brands with technical R&D capabilities and unique product requirements.
ODM (Original Design Manufacturing) Manufacturer provides pre-designed models; buyer selects and customizes (e.g., branding, minor specs). Faster time-to-market. Best for new market entrants or brands seeking cost-effective, proven designs with faster launch cycles.

Recommendation: Use ODM for rapid scaling; invest in OEM for long-term brand differentiation.


3. White Label vs. Private Label: Branding Strategy Comparison

Feature White Label Private Label
Definition Generic product rebranded by buyer. No exclusivity. Custom-designed product exclusive to buyer. Full branding control.
Customization Limited (only logo/packaging) High (design, specs, packaging, features)
MOQ Low to moderate Moderate to high
Development Time 2–4 weeks 8–14 weeks (includes R&D, tooling)
Cost Efficiency High (shared tooling, economies of scale) Lower per-unit cost at scale; higher upfront investment
Brand Differentiation Low High
Best For Budget-conscious rebranders, distributors Brands building unique market positioning

Insight: Private Label delivers stronger ROI for brands targeting premium segments; White Label suits volume-driven B2B distributors.


4. Estimated Cost Breakdown (Per Unit, 600x600mm Frameless LED Panel Light)

Cost Component Description Estimated Cost (USD)
Materials LED chips (SMD 2835/3030), PMMA diffuser, aluminum PCB, driver (constant current), frameless bezel $8.50 – $11.00
Labor Assembly, soldering, testing, quality control (fully automated lines reduce labor cost) $1.20 – $1.80
Packaging Standard export carton, foam inserts, labeling (neutral or branded) $1.00 – $1.50
Overhead & Profit Margin Factory overhead, QA, profit (typically 15–20%) $1.80 – $2.50
Total Estimated FOB Cost $12.50 – $16.80

Notes:
– Costs assume standard 40W, 4000K, CRI >80, 120lm/W, CE/ROHS compliant
– UL listing adds $1.00–$1.50/unit (third-party testing)
– Smart variants (DALI, 0–10V, Bluetooth) add $2.50–$5.00/unit


5. Price Tiers by MOQ (FOB Shenzhen, 600x600mm Standard Panel)

MOQ Unit Price (USD) Total Cost (USD) Notes
500 units $16.50 $8,250 White Label or low-customization Private Label. Limited tooling fees may apply.
1,000 units $14.80 $14,800 Standard ODM/Private Label. Volume discount activated.
5,000 units $12.90 $64,500 Full Private Label scalability. Custom tooling amortized. Best value.

Additional Charges (One-Time):
– Custom mold/tooling: $1,500 – $3,500 (reusable across orders)
– Sample fee: $80 – $150 (refundable against MOQ)
– UL/ETL Certification Support: $2,000 – $4,000 (per model, shared or exclusive)

Distinguishing Factories vs. Trading Companies: Lighting-Specific Indicators

Verification Point True Factory Trading Company Risk Level
Core Assets Owns SMT machines (e.g., Yamaha YS24), aluminum CNC lines, aging chambers Shows “partner factory” videos; no machine ownership proof ⚠️ Critical
Technical Dialogue Engineers discuss:
– Junction temperature control
– Glare index (UGR<19)
– CRI>90 solutions
Quotes generic specs; deflects thermal questions ⚠️ High
Pricing Structure Itemized BOM (e.g., $8.20 for 60x60cm panel: $3.10 LED module, $2.40 driver) Single-line pricing; refuses cost breakdown ⚠️ Medium
Minimum Order MOQ based on production batches (e.g., 500 units/model) MOQ = container load (e.g., 1,000 units across models) ⚠️ Medium
Certification Ownership Holds factory audit reports (e.g., TÜV Rheinland FAW) Shows “supplier” certificates; no audit trail ⚠️ Critical
